Kenya News - Tuesday, June 17, 2025
Daily Summary

Kenya News - Tuesday, June 17, 2025

Protests continue in Nairobi demanding justice for blogger Albert Ojwang, with injuries reported during clashes. Police have arrested an officer linked to the shooting of a mask vendor. President Ruto has pledged 2 million Kenyan Shillings to Ojwang's family. Rain is expected across the country this week.
